B-25D "Steamin' Jean" 41-30567 parked at Greenville Airfield
Caption: "Steamin' Jean' B-25D 130567 Greenville, S. C. June 1943
Original crew: L to R: SSgt Frank Travis, bombadier/navigator (in nose escape hatch) pilot Lt. Claude B. Simmons, co-pilot Lt. Howard L. Myers, radio-gunner SSgt Charles A. Moran, engineer-gunner SSgt Homer C. Guise. Nicknamed "Steamin' Jean" on the left side of the nose with "Starlite Room" below the nose escape hatch.
Credit: USAAF via Mindy LeVeque niece of Lt. Howard L. Myers  Date: June 1943
